摘要
The paper describes several model, where the computer-aided software design system BPsim. SD was used. Some of them were existing projects with available output data, and were used for system verification as the baseline deployments. Namely, the University Information System is the project of such kind, and has been developed earlier, partially by authors, who had all the initial data to be able to reproduce important aspects within the current system. Others became the real examples of system use, and allowed the customers to achieve benefit from automated software design. That is the development of software for the independent shareholders registry, including sub-system for documents registration, transfer agent exchange module and an electronic docflow system. Positive deployment experience proves effectiveness of presented software.
